Oxygen is flowing through a nominal 2 inch schedule 40 steel pipe pipe at a velocity of 10 ft/s. The oxygen is at a fairly constant pressure of 50 psia and at a temperature of 90 deg F. (there would be some pressure drop in the pipe as the oxygen flows along but we will ignore this and assume that at the point where we measure the velocity, the pressure and temperature are also measured) What is the mass flow rate of oxygen in lbm/s? Note that the inside diameter of a nominal 2 inch schedule 40 steel pipe is 2.067inches. Assume ideal gas principles apply.
